The powerful earthquake that struck Japan in March was a 9.0-magnitude event. But this was not, as some people may assume, as registered on the Richter scale, the famed measuring system dating to the 1930s. Seismologists today do not use the Richter scale as a universal tool for measuring earthquakes, because it does not ...

Subduction zones: •Capable of generating extremely powerful earthquakes. •Subduction zone earthquakes are associated with convergent plate boundaries with compressional stress. •The Cascadia fault is part of a subduction zone located in the northwestern United States. The notion of a magnitude scale for earthquakes was developed by Dr. Charles F. Richter, who recognized that the measured amplitude of a seismic wave (the size of the wiggle recorded on a seismogram) provides a good estimate of the energy released by an earthquake.When an earthquake occurs, the shockwaves of released energy that shake the Earth and temporarily turn soft deposits, such as clay, into jelly (liquefaction) are called seismic waves, from the Greek ‘seismos’ meaning ‘earthquake’. 2023 Turkey-Syria Earthquake. On Feb. 6, a magnitude 7.8 earthquake occurred in southern Turkey near the northern border of Syria. This quake was followed approximately nine hours later by a magnitude 7.5 earthquake located around 59 miles (95 kilometers) to the southwest. In Japan, earthquakes are measured on both the Magnitude and Seismic Intensity scales. What's the difference, and why does it matter?Two scales are used commonly to measure earthquake strength. You can measure an earthquake either by its size where the rock slipped, or by the amount of shaking that is experienced at a place that interests you. Both measures are used. The measure of the size of the earthquake where it occurred is the “magnitude.”. The initial jolt was followed a ... ms in behavioral science Richter's First Scale . The pioneering seismologist Charles Richter started in the 1930s by simplifying everything he could think of. He chose one standard instrument, a Wood-Anderson seismograph, used only nearby earthquakes in Southern California, and took only one piece of data—the distance A in millimeters that the seismograph needle moved.
